What steps would you take to construct an angle bisector? How many arcs would you make?

Answers

Answer 1

The steps are as follows:

1. Put the compass at one point on the vertex of the angle and draw an arc that intersects both sides of the angle.

2. Now, draw an arc from each of these points of intersection, in such a way that the arcs intersect in the interior of the angle. Keep the compass open in the same amount throughout this step.

3. Now, draw a ray/line from the vertex of the angle to the intersection point of the two arcs drawn during step 2.

How many arcs would you make? We will draw 3 arcs.

What is the solution of the equation when solved over the complex numbers? X2+24=0

Answers

Final answer:

The solution to the equation x² + 24 = 0 over the complex numbers is x = ±2√(6)i. After isolating x² on one side, we take the square root of both sides and introduce the imaginary unit i because the number under the square root is negative.

Explanation:

To solve the equation x² + 24 = 0 over the complex numbers, we need to find values of x that satisfy the equation. This is a quadratic equation with 'a' as 1 (the coefficient of x²), 'b' as 0 (since there is no x term), and 'c' as 24.

We will first isolate x² by subtracting 24 from both sides of the equation:

x² = -24

Next, to find x, we take the square root of both sides. Remember that when we take the square root of a negative number, we get an imaginary number. The square root of -24 can be expressed as:

x = ±√(-24)

This simplifies to:

x = ±√(24) × ±i

Since √(24) is √(4 × 6), which simplifies to 2√(6), the final solution in terms of complex numbers is:

x = ±2√(6)i

PLEASE HELP!  The high school band wants to sell two types of cookies, chocolate chip and peanut butter, as a fundraiser. A dozen chocolate chip cookies requires 2 cups of flour and 1 egg. A dozen peanut butter cookies uses 3 cups of flour and 4 eggs. The club has 90 cups of flour and 80 eggs on hand. The profit on the chocolate chip cookies is $1 per dozen and on the peanut butter is $1.50 per dozen. If they want to offer both types of cookies, how many of each cookie should the club make to maximize profits?
a.
infeasible solutions
c.
24 dozen chocolate chip
14 dozen peanut butter
b.
30 dozen chocolate chip
25 dozen peanut butter
d.
20 dozen chocolate chip
18 dozen peanut butter

Answers

Answer:

24 dozen chocolate chip

14 dozen peanut butter

Step-by-step explanation:

x = number of dozen chocolate chip cookies

y = number of dozen peanut butter cookies

Total number of cups of flour is:

2x + 3y ≤ 90

Total number of eggs is:

x + 4y ≤ 80

Total profit is:

P = x + 1.5y

Since this is multiple choice, one method would be to calculate the profit for each option, then choose the one that's largest.

But let's try solving this algebraically.  x and y are positive integers, and we want them to be as large as possible.

Let's start by assuming the solution is on the line 2x + 3y = 90.

x + 4y ≤ 80

2x + 8y ≤ 160

90 − 3y + 8y ≤ 160

5y ≤ 70

y ≤ 14

If y = 14, x = 24, and P = 45.

Now let's assume the solution is on the line x + 4y = 80.

2x + 3y ≤ 90

2 (80 − 4y) + 3y ≤ 90

160 − 8y + 3y ≤ 90

70 ≤ 5y

14 ≤ y

Therefore, to maximize the profit, they should bake 24 dozen chocolate chip cookies and 14 dozen peanut butter cookies.
